Does Lexus have a hardtop convertible?

No, Lexus does not currently offer a hardtop convertible model in its lineup. Lexus is known for its luxury sedans, SUVs, and hybrid vehicles, but the brand has not produced a retractable hardtop convertible in recent years.


Lexus Convertible Models


While Lexus does not have a hardtop convertible, the brand has offered a soft-top convertible in the past. The Lexus SC 430 was a luxury convertible produced from 2001 to 2010. It featured a power-retractable soft top and a V8 engine. However, the SC 430 was discontinued, and Lexus has not introduced a new convertible model since then.


Why Doesn't Lexus Offer a Hardtop Convertible?


There are a few potential reasons why Lexus has not produced a hardtop convertible in recent years:



  • Market Demand: Convertible sales, in general, have declined in recent years as consumer preferences have shifted towards SUVs and crossovers. Lexus may not see sufficient demand to justify the development and production of a hardtop convertible model.

  • Engineering Challenges: Designing and engineering a retractable hardtop convertible can be technically complex and costly. Lexus may have determined that the investment required does not align with the brand's overall product strategy.

  • Cannibalizing Other Models: Introducing a hardtop convertible could potentially take sales away from Lexus' existing coupe and sedan models, which are core to the brand's lineup. The company may have decided to focus on those core models instead.


While Lexus does not currently offer a hardtop convertible, the brand's lineup continues to evolve, and it's possible that a new convertible model could be introduced in the future if market conditions and consumer preferences change.

What are the problems with hard-top convertibles?


Cons of a Hard-Top Convertible
Retractable hard-top convertibles almost always suffer a weight penalty versus their soft-top cousins. The extra mass is due not just to the roof panels themselves but also to the more complicated and robust mechanisms required to support the top while it is being folded out of sight.

Is the Lexus LC convertible hardtop?


With a shape designed to help aerodynamically tame the air around you and a lightweight, four-layer soft-top construction, the LC Convertible offers a quiet, comfortable ride. The soft top opens or closes in approximately 15 seconds at driving speeds of up to 30 mph and can be stored without impacting luggage capacity.
